Tropical Green Smoothie Packs

These tropical green smoothie packs are easy to prep for the week and the perfect way to start your day!
Prep Time10 minutes
Total Time10 minutes
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Servings: 5 smoothie packs
Author: Amber Goulden

Ingredients

For 5 smoothie packs:

  • 16 ounces frozen chopped mango
  • 16 ounces frozen chopped pineapple
  • 16 ounces fresh or frozen spinach
  • 1, 13.5 ounce can full-fat coconut milk
  • 5 scoops of protein powder or collagen peptides
  • 5 teaspoons chia seeds

For a single smoothie:

  • 1/2 cup frozen chopped mango
  • 1/2 cup frozen chopped pineapple
  • 1 cup packed fresh baby spinach may also use frozen
  • 1/4 cup full-fat coconut milk
  • 1 scoop protein powder or collagen peptides
  • 1 teaspoon chia seeds additional for garnish, optional
  • 3/4 cup water or coconut water

Instructions

  • Spoon all of the ingredients into individual bags. (Yes! you'll just pour the coconut milk right on top.). It will freeze as one big ball of goodness. Note: if you don't have a high-powered blender, we recommend freezing the coconut milk into ice cubes first, then dividing between the bags.
  • When you're ready to make your smoothie, empty the contents of your bag into a blender or bullet with 3/4 cup water. Blend until smooth.
  • Pour in your favorite glass, garnish with a pinch more of chia seeds (if you want), and enjoy.
